This test is used to determine if you have a current mononucleosis infection or if you have been infected in the past.
The mono test is primarily taken when symptoms such as fever, headache, swollen glands, and fatigue are present. The test may be repeated when it is initially negative but suspicion of mono remains high. If this test is positive, another test to indicate if the the infection is current may be required. This second test is called the Epstein Barr Virus test.
If you have ever had mono in the past, you will always test positive. If you believe you have a current mono infection and have tested positive for mono before, you should not have this test but should instead have the Epstein Barr Virus test.
